ArmInfo. The large and medium-sized taxpayers of Armenia increased the volume of tax payments by 9% per annum or by 39.9 billion AMD, sending 483 billion AMD to the state treasury for 11 months in 2017.
According to the press service of Armenian State Revenue Committee, overpayments after the growth in the same period of 2016 by 16.4 billion AMD, in the same period of 2017 decreased by 4.7 billion AMD, which, taking into account the growth of tax revenues, amounted to 61 billion drams. In the period from December 1, 2016 to December 1, 2017 for all taxes and payments, the total amount of overpayments decreased by 13.7 billion drams or 7.3%.
Meanwhile, in January-November 2017 it was possible to reduce tax liabilities by 5.8 billion AMD or 36.3%. During the same period, tax revenues from taxpayers with a high level of risk could be increased by 20%, whereas a group with a low level of risk ensured an increase in tax revenues by 7%.
At the end of 11 months, the number of tax invoices issued increased by 19%, and sales turnover by them - by 10.5%, fiscal revenues by cash registers - by 11%. As a result of meetings and explanatory work with individual taxpayers, according to the submitted corrected calculations, in January-November 2017, the amount of VAT and profit tax increased by 3.9 billion drams.
